github-translator
时间: 2023-05-03 08:04:29 浏览: 312
GitHub Translator是GitHub官方的翻译工具,旨在促进GitHub社区的国际化和本地化。该工具的使用非常简单,用户只需在GitHub上创建一个Issue并选择“翻译”标签即可开始翻译工作。通过这个标签,其他用户可以轻松地找到您的翻译工作并在其中参与。
GitHub Translator采用了人工与自动翻译相结合的方式来完成翻译工作。当用户发起翻译请求时,一些文本会自动翻译成其它语言,以便提供已知的翻译术语和翻译建议。而其他的文本则需要由人工翻译完成。这种方式既可以提高翻译的质量,又可以节省时间和人力资源。
GitHub Translator将翻译内容分为两个层次:仓库级别和页面级别。仓库级别的翻译会影响仓库内所有文件和页面的翻译,而页面级别的翻译仅影响当前页面的翻译。这种设计使得翻译者可以在对整个仓库进行翻译的同时,也可以针对特定页面进行较为精细的翻译工作。
总的来说,GitHub Translator是一个方便易用的翻译工具,它促进了开源社区的本地化和国际化,使不同语种的用户们更容易地分享和协作。
相关问题
npm install --save github-markdown-css/github-markdown.css
npm install --save github-markdown-css/github-markdown.css 是一条命令,用于在使用npm包管理器的项目中安装名为 github-markdown-css 的包,并将其保存为依赖。该包提供了 GitHub 风格的 Markdown 样式表,可以用于在网页中渲染 Markdown 内容。
npm 是 Node.js 的包管理工具,可以用于管理项目中使用的各种包。通过执行 npm install 命令,可以从 npm 的仓库中下载并安装指定的包。--save 参数表示将包添加到项目的 package.json 文件中的 dependencies 部分,这样在其他环境中重新安装项目时,可以使用这个文件快速安装项目所需的所有依赖。
github-markdown-css 是一个开源的项目,旨在提供类似 GitHub 上 Markdown 渲染的样式。通过执行 npm install --save github-markdown-css/github-markdown.css 命令,我们可以将该项目的样式表文件 github-markdown.css 安装到我们的项目中。
一旦安装完成,我们就可以在项目中引入该样式表文件,并在网页中使用这个样式表来渲染 Markdown 内容。通过使用 GitHub 风格的样式,我们可以达到类似于 GitHub 上展示 Markdown 内容的效果。这对于需要在网页中展示 Markdown 文档或记录的项目非常有用,可以提供一致且美观的显示效果。
svg-icon icon-github-fill
根据提供的引用内容,我们可以得出以下结论:
1. 在main.js中引入了'./icons'模块,即import './icons'。这个模块是用来注册全局的svg-icon组件的。
2. 在src/icons/index.js文件中,引入了Vue和SvgIcon组件,并且全局注册了svg-icon组件。同时,还使用了require.context函数来导入所有的svg文件,并使用了requireAll函数来处理导入的文件。
3. 在webpack的配置文件中,设置了svg-sprite-loader来处理svg文件。其中,通过chainWebpack函数来做相关配置,包括删除了prefetch插件,设置了svg-sprite-loader的规则,并且将svg文件的处理排除了src/icons目录以外的文件。
4. 根据问题中的描述,"svg-icon icon-github-fill"是用来指定icon-class属性的值,以展示具体的图标。但是,根据提供的引用内容,无法直接找到与"svg-icon icon-github-fill"对应的具体内容。
简而言之,根据提供的引用内容,我们可以知道在这个项目中,svg-icon组件被全局注册,并且通过引入svg文件来展示不同的图标。但是,无法确定"svg-icon icon-github-fill"具体对应的图标是什么。